Abstract

See full text

A concentration of HC in an exhaust gas is estimated with a high degree of accuracy by making use of a particulate matter processing apparatus (1). In the particulate matter processing apparatus (1) in which a processing part (3) with an electrode (5) installed therein is arranged in an exhaust passage (2) of an internal combustion engine, wherein particulate matter is caused to aggregate by generating a potential difference between the electrode (5) and the processing part (3), provision is made for a power supply (6) that is connected to the electrode (5) and applies a voltage thereto, an insulation part (4) that insulates electricity between the processing part (3) and the exhaust passage (2), and a ground part (53) that grounds the processing part (3), a detection device (9) that detects an electric current in the ground part (53), and an estimation device (7) that estimates a concentration of HC in an exhaust gas based on the electric current detected by the detection device (9) at the time when the voltage is applied to the electrode (5) by means of the power supply (6).
